《单片机C语言程序设计实训100例——基于8051+Proteus仿真》是一本针对初学者和进阶者深入学习单片机C语言编程的实用教材。该书通过100个具体的实训案例,帮助读者掌握8051系列单片机的C语言编程技巧,并利用Proteus仿真软件进行验证和调试,从而提升实践能力。 8051单片机是微控制器领域中最经典的芯片之一,广泛应用于各种嵌入式系统。本书以8051为核心,讲解C语言在单片机开发中的应用。C语言具有语法简洁、可移植性强的特点,是编写单片机程序的首选语言之一。通过学习C语言,开发者可以更高效地控制硬件资源,实现复杂的功能。 Proteus是一款强大的电子电路仿真软件,它集成了电路设计、元器件库、虚拟仪表、单片机模型等众多功能,使得开发者无需实际硬件就能进行单片机程序的仿真测试。在Proteus中,8051单片机模型可以与外围电路一起模拟运行,实时查看和分析程序执行效果,极大地降低了实验成本和时间。 书中的“第01 基础部分仿真文件”很可能是包含了一些基础的单片机操作实例,比如LED灯控制、数码管显示、键盘输入等。这些基本操作是理解和掌握单片机系统的基础,通过这些实例,读者可以学习到如何初始化单片机、设置I/O口、定时器/计数器的使用、中断系统等关键概念。 在单片机C语言编程中,了解数据类型、运算符、流程控制语句、函数等基础知识是必要的。同时,单片机特有的硬件接口操作,如GPIO(通用输入输出)、A/D转换、D/A转换、串行通信(UART)等,也是学习的重点。通过Proteus的仿真,可以直观地看到代码执行的结果,有助于理解并解决实际问题。 在实际应用中,单片机常用于智能家居、工业控制、汽车电子、仪器仪表等领域。掌握8051单片机C语言编程及仿真技术,不仅能够提升个人技能,也为未来在这些领域的工作打下坚实基础。 总结来说,《单片机C语言程序设计实训100例——基于8051+Proteus仿真》是学习8051单片机C语言编程的实用资源,结合Proteus仿真工具,能够帮助读者快速掌握单片机编程技能,并通过实践加深理论理解。通过基础部分的仿真文件,读者可以从最简单的电路开始,逐步建立起对单片机系统操作的全面认识。
- 1
- 2
- 3
- 4
- 5
- 6
- 8
- 粉丝: 8
- 资源: 26
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 基于Python的EducationCRM管理系统前端设计源码
- 基于Django4.0+Python3.10的在线学习系统Scss设计源码
- 基于activiti6和jeesite4的dreamFlow工作流管理设计源码
- 基于Python实现的简单植物大战僵尸脚本设计源码
- 基于Java及Web技术的医药管理系统设计源码
- 基于Objective-C的cordova-plugin-wechat插件开发源码研究
- 基于Python语言的SocialNetworkBackend社交数据分析系统后端设计源码
- 基于Python的pytracking-master目标跟踪dimp方法设计源码
- 基于PHP、JavaScript、CSS的zibll主题美化插件设计源码
- 本页包含特定于 FT600Q-B / FT601Q-B SuperSpeed USB3.0 系列的示例应用程序